"I'm sorry I'm gonna be an ass, but I my OCD compels me to wear my "practicing scientist hat" to point out a few thing. First of all, the title of the chart is misleading, because there isn't a 1:1 ratio between fanfiction writers and the number of fics. Rather, sum of fics > sum of writers since usually you'll have a writer posting several fics.

Then there's the fact AO3 didn't exist in 2002.

And finally, for some reason, AO3 has two Taichi/ Yamato categories, one with 307 stories, and one with 75 stories, making them the dominant ship by an insignificant margin as 382>335:

In the image, we can clearly see  Takari has the third largest story count, so I'm not sure OP used all the tools in their arsenal, but just in case they weren't aware it was an option, it's possible to filter by ship on AO3, thus eliminating any need for sample sizing (all the relevant data is available).

So the most accurate way to name the chart would be: "most prolific writers in the digimon fandom by ship (AO3)

Otherwise, great pie. Perfect for pride month ^^” - DeAlice

Mixing up the Digimon Characters

I’d like to pose the question to the Digimon fandom, if you could take one or two character/s from a sequel season and place them into the Digimon Adventure 01 season who would it be? Who do you think would mix in best with the original 8? 

I think Juri would mix in really well with the original team. I love the idea of Junpei as well but am unsure if he would work well with the dynamic of the original 8 characters, but it’s kinda cool to think of what digimon I’d give him (full disclosure I’ve often fantasized about a version of Frontier where they have partners, I think Junpei should have a machine type digimon). 

If we include 02 characters into this game then I also think Ken would have blended real well into the original season, and honestly you could just age him up a little, replace Devimon with the digimon emperor, and you could incorporate him into season one without having to even change much of the major story beats. Iori is also someone I think could easily mix in with the original 8 on his own. 

Thoughts? I’ve been thinking about this a lot since the reboot (I’m also finally getting around to watching Xros Wars and will then give Appmon a go).

In Honor of Kyoto Animation

After these horrifying news, I’ve decided to do a recap on KyoAni’s main titles from their foundation until now as a homage for its staff, especially the victims and their families. We don’t know where the studio will be going from now, but we do know of its journey until the present moment. There were hits and there were misses, but it overall deserves appreciation now more than ever.

This is going to be a bit long but they deserve it all and more.

Nurse Witch Komugi-chan Magikarte (2002)

Inuyasha Movies 1 to 3 (2001-2003)

Munto (2003-2009)

Full Metal Panic! Fumoffu/TSR (2003-2006)

Air (2005)

Kanon (2006)

Clannad (2007-2009)

Suzumiya Haruhi (2006-2010)

Lucky Star (2007-2008)

K-ON! (2009-2011)

Nichijou (2011)

Hyouka (2012)

Chuunibyou demo Koi ga Shitai! (2012-2018)

Tamako Market (2013-2014)

Free! (2013-present)

Kyoukai no Kanata (2013-2015)

Amagi Brilliant Park (2014-2015)

Hibike! Euphonium (2015-present)

Musaigen no Phantom World (2016)

Koe no Katachi (2016-2017)

Kobayashi-san Chi no Maid Dragon (2017)

Violet Evergarden (2018-present)

Tsurune (2018-2019)
